Second victim in Gomoa Akraman violence dead

A middle-aged man, who sustained gunshot wounds during a cross-fire at Gomoa Akraman in the Gomoa East District of the Central region, has died.

Central Regional Police Public Relations Officer, DSP Irene Oppong revealed this on Adom FM’s morning show, Dwaso Nsem programme, Tuesday.

She said the victim, she gave his name as Russia, died Monday evening at the Winneba Trauma Hospital where he was receiving treatment.

This comes following the brutal murder of Gyaasehene of Gomoa Akraman, Yaw Egyir popularly known as ‘Osebo’ over an alleged land dispute.

DSP Oppong said no arrest has so far been made..

She assured of maximum security in the area due to the increasing crime rate in the area.

The PRO appealed to residents in Kasoa and its environs to volunteer information to enable police effect arrest.

She said they have been able to restore calm in the area and has also increased police visibility.
